Seasonal selections will be featured at the Winter Concert of the East Stroudsburg University/Community Concert Band, the university’s largest and most visible instrumental ensemble, on December 8 at ESU.

The program will also feature music selections from Carmina Burana by Carl Orff and Sleep by Eric Whitacre.

Curtain time for the concert, sponsored by the department of music, is 7 p.m. at the Cecilia S. Cohen Recital Hall in the university’s Fine and Performing Arts Center, Normal and Marguerite streets. The performance is open to the public at no cost.

The ESU Bands Program is supported by the Student Activity Association, the ESU Parents Association, the ESU Foundation and the ESU Alumni Association.
